The Red Scare is turning lavender, and it's State Department employees Bob and Norma's job to root out "sexual deviants." Trouble is, they're both secretly gay and married to each other's partners. As the 50's sitcom-style hijinks turn ever more high stakes, the couples have to decide just how much they're willing to give up to stay safe.

Recommeneded for mature audiences.

The KY Museum is free and open to the public Weds-Sat 9AM- 4PM. Note: The museum will be closed for WKU's Spring Break March 16-21.

Abound Credit Union Celebration of the Arts is one of the largest annual art shows in the region. 

Over 150 artists have entered this juried exhibit in the categories of: Ceramics & Glass, Drawing/Illustration, Fiber Art , Graphic Design/Digital Art, Mixed Media, Painting, Photography, Printmaking, Sculpture, and Watercolor.
